Single Scanning

Implementing single scanning of barcodes using the Scandit Data Capture SDK can be done in two ways:

  • (Recommended) Implementing SparkScan, our pre-built UI and workflow for barcode scanning.
  • Implementing the low-level Barcode Capture API.

The SparkScan API provides pre-built UI elements (trigger button, camera view, camera controls), a complete scanning workflow (visual, audio, and haptic feedback, and UI transitions on scan) and offers additional functionality needed to achieve optimal scanning UX, such as:

  • Triggering scans via a hardware trigger (volume or dedicated hardware button)
  • Pre-built code rejection and error handling options
  • Option to choose between single and continuous scanning, programmatically or with hold gesture
  • Battery-optimizing features such as idle timeout and camera standby
  • A floating UI that keeps your focus on the tasks at hand while offering the best scanning performances

All of the above functionality is available out-of-the-box, without having to create it yourself via the low-level API.

Both SparkScan and Barcode Capture include AI-powered scanning capabilities that automatically handle challenging scenarios such as avoiding unintentional scans, selecting barcodes in dense environments, scanning damaged barcodes with OCR fallback, and intelligently filtering duplicate scans.
